Fiji Revenue and Customs Service Transforming the Tax Landscape and the Taxpayer Experience

Fiji Revenue and Customs Service (FRCS), the largest tax authority in Fiji, needed to modernize its aging tax administration systems and improve taxpayer services. With a 30-year-old ERP, incomplete data, and paper-based processes, FRCS wanted a self-service platform that would let more than 300,000 taxpayers lodge returns and access accounts and business-license services online. SAP S/4HANA and SAP Tax & Revenue Management were used to support this transformation.

SAP helped FRCS implement a workflow-driven, integrated digital tax platform with 24x7 online access and automated approvals. The result was improved workforce efficiency, better taxpayer compliance, and a 360-degree view of taxpayers, along with measurable impact including a 20% reduction in paper usage, more than 113,000 taxpayers registered online, about 170,000 PAYE returns filed online over two years, and about 260,000 VAT returns filed online over 3.5 years.
